boxmill consulting - Mixed-Use Development - London, SE1, Emerson Street, Bankside

Date: 07 Oct 2003

Property developer, Chelsfield plc and project manager boxmill consulting have launched the workshop studios, Emerson Studios at 4-8 Emerson Street, Bankside, London, SE1 on to the market.

The 2,781 sq m (29,310 sq ft) former light industrial was converted from a dilapidated shell and refurbished into a six-storey development. It was designed and project managed by boxmill consulting who transformed it into 11 workshop studios from 78 sq m (840 sq ft) to 652 sq m (7,021 sq ft).

boxmill consulting director, Danny Chalkley comments: “We are extremely pleased with the results of the project, especially with its location orientated towards the creative industry. It meets the market lifestyle demand for work studios close to living accommodation.”

The fourth floor is occupied by DHA Lighting.

Edward Symmonds and Partners and James Andrew International are the agents for the remaining units.
